首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在Debian上编译GTK 3应用程序

需要以下步骤:

  1. 安装编译工具链:首先,确保你的Debian系统已经安装了必要的编译工具链,包括gcc、make和pkg-config。可以使用以下命令安装:
  2. 安装编译工具链:首先,确保你的Debian系统已经安装了必要的编译工具链,包括gcc、make和pkg-config。可以使用以下命令安装:
  3. 安装GTK 3开发库:GTK是一种用于创建图形用户界面的开发库,GTK 3是其最新版本。在Debian上,可以使用以下命令安装GTK 3开发库:
  4. 安装GTK 3开发库:GTK是一种用于创建图形用户界面的开发库,GTK 3是其最新版本。在Debian上,可以使用以下命令安装GTK 3开发库:
  5. 编写GTK 3应用程序:使用你喜欢的文本编辑器创建一个GTK 3应用程序的源代码文件,通常以.c或.cpp为扩展名。在这个文件中,你可以使用GTK 3提供的函数和类来创建用户界面和处理事件。
  6. 编译应用程序:打开终端,进入你的应用程序源代码所在的目录,并使用以下命令编译应用程序:
  7. 编译应用程序:打开终端,进入你的应用程序源代码所在的目录,并使用以下命令编译应用程序:
  8. 这个命令将会使用gcc编译器将你的源代码文件编译成一个可执行文件。pkg-config --cflags --libs gtk+-3.0部分用于告诉编译器在编译过程中使用GTK 3开发库。
  9. 运行应用程序:编译成功后,你可以使用以下命令运行你的GTK 3应用程序:
  10. 运行应用程序:编译成功后,你可以使用以下命令运行你的GTK 3应用程序:
  11. 这将会在终端中启动你的应用程序,并显示应用程序的用户界面。

总结起来,编译GTK 3应用程序的步骤包括安装编译工具链、安装GTK 3开发库、编写应用程序源代码、编译应用程序,并最终运行应用程序。通过使用GTK 3,你可以创建跨平台的图形用户界面应用程序,并在Debian上进行编译和运行。

腾讯云相关产品和产品介绍链接地址:

  • 腾讯云服务器(CVM):提供弹性计算能力,满足各种规模的应用需求。产品介绍
  • 腾讯云对象存储(COS):提供安全、稳定、低成本的云端存储服务。产品介绍
  • 腾讯云容器服务(TKE):基于Kubernetes的容器管理服务,简化容器化应用的部署和管理。产品介绍
  • 腾讯云人工智能(AI):提供丰富的人工智能服务和解决方案,包括图像识别、语音识别、自然语言处理等。产品介绍
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券